Jessica believes that she succeeds in high school because she works hard, earned a place on the basketball team because she practices constantly, and cooks well because she takes cooking classes. Julian Rotter would say that Jessica has _______.

an internal locus of control.

Dan avoids applying to college because he doubts he can succeed. He is working a retail job, but he tends to focus on the things he does wrong. In fact, he has almost no confidence in his abilities , and when he experiences a setback at work he is ready to quit. Albert Bandura would say Dan has ______.

Low self-efficacy

A(an) ______ locus of control is the belief that our outcomes are outside of our control; an _____ locus of control is the belief that we control our own outcomes.

external; internal

Which statement summarizes the main idea of reciprocal determinism?

our behavior, cognitive processes, and situational context all influence each other.
